What happens when you step into the CEO seat of a small consultancy in a niche market, with big ambitions, PE backing, and a bold growth target?
In this episode of Climb in Consulting, Nick Synnott chats to Stu Packham, Group CEO of Alchemist, about how he led the business from a modest $2M learning consultancy to a $20M global challenger brand.
Before stepping into consulting, Stu spent years in the world of recruitment - building teams, scaling businesses, and getting under the skin of what makes people tick. It was that deep experience, paired with a well-timed chat with a close friend, that led to him being put forward for the CEO role at Alchemist in 2019.
What followed was nothing short of a whirlwind. Stu stepped into a six-person business without meeting any of the team beforehand, not exactly your textbook onboarding. From that uncertain start came a high-speed journey of transformation: expanding into the US, building out UK operations, and laying the groundwork for a global presence. Stu didn’t just steer the ship, he helped it grow new engines mid-flight.
This episode is a behind-the-scenes look at what it really takes to lead a PE-backed consultancy through rapid growth. Stu shares:
- How fractional leadership became a secret weapon for scale
- What a People function looks like when growth is the goal
- How to prepare (mentally and practically) for due diligence
- The biggest lessons he’s taking into Alchemist’s next chapter
